A male patient is taking cimetidine (Tagamet). Which adverse effect is more likely to occur with cimetidine than with other histamine2 receptor antagonists?
 
  A) Hypoxia
  B) Hypertension
  C) Gynecomastia
  D) Seizures

Question 2

A patient is taking dextroamphetamine for ADHD. He has developed constipation since beginning therapy. Which of the following should the patient be taught?
 
  A) Take an OTC laxative daily.
  B) Increase fiber intake.
  C) Take diphenoxylate hydrochloride (Lomotil).
  D) Take metronidazole (Flagyl).

Answer to Question 1

C
Feedback:
Gynecomastia is an adverse effect that is more likely to occur with cimetidine than with other histamine2 antagonists. Hypoxia, hypertension, and seizures are not adverse effects of cimetidine.

Answer to Question 2

B
Feedback:
A patient who is experiencing constipation should be instructed to increase fiber in his diet. The patient should not take a laxative. The patient should not be instructed to take diphenoxylate hydrochloride (Lomotil) because it is an antidiarrheal agent. The patient should not be given metronidazole (Flagyl).

Children with strabismus (crossed eyes) can be treated. They are not able to outgrow this condition on their own, but with help, it can be more easily corrected at a younger age. It is important for infants to have eye examinations as early as possible in their development and then another at age 2 years.

Colchicine is a highly poisonous alkaloid originally extracted from a type of saffron plant that is used mainly to treat gout.

Intradermal injections are somewhat difficult to correctly administer because the skin layers are so thin that it is easy to accidentally punch through to the deeper subcutaneous layer.
